Description
She can tame unicorns, kiss frogs, and fight dragons and she is very good at fixing things before it's time for bed.
In The Unicorn Mix-Up, Princess Minna is so tired that she mixes up the solutions to problems across the kingdom. She fights a unicorn, kisses a dragon, and tries to tame a frog - which doesn't work at all! Can she fix all that has gone wrong and make a new friend along the way?
Full of colorful illustrations, these short, funny stories are perfect for readers just moving on from picture books.

About the Author
Kirsty Applebaum was born in Essex, England. She has had a wide variety of jobs including bookselling, railroad re-signaling, putting lids on perfume bottles, and teaching Pilates. She now lives with her husband on top of a hill in Winchester, England.
